Day balance maintenance (TME107B)

Related topics

On this panel you maintain day balances. The panel can be accessed in two modes: Add and Change.

Employee
Date
Enter the calculation date of the day balance.
Wage type
Enter a code, from Work with wage types, that is valid for the wage group to which the employee belongs.
Day balance type
Enter the day balance type.

The following codes apply:

Code Description
0 Detail
1 Total
Hours
Enter the duration in hours with two decimals.
Reference
Only shown if the day balance type is 0 (Detail) and you are in Change mode. Indicates the reference to a manufacturing order, project, etc.

In Add mode

The following fields are only shown in Add mode:

Activity/Version/Phase/Line
Note: Only shown if DC1 Project is installed and activated in the company in which you are working. Enter the valid codes for activity, version, phase and line if the day balance refers to a manufacturing project. Entered codes must be the key of a project activity line.
Project
Note: Not shown if DC1 Project is installed and activated in the company in which you are working. Enter a code from Work with projects. The selected project must be active, i.e., the booked date must be within the defined start and end date of the project.
Cost centre
Enter the cost centre code if the day balance refers to a cost centre.
Manufact. order/oper
Enter the order and operation number if the day balance refers to a manufacturing order. Entered values must be a valid operation.
Consolidated order
Enter the consolidated order number if the day balance refers to a consolidated order. Entered value must be a valid order, i.e., it must have been started.
Quantity approved
Enter the approved quantity with correct number of decimals. Note: Quantities can only be entered if Transfer quantities on the Wage type transfer details maintenance panel has been specified for the wage type.
Rejected
Enter the rejected quantity with correct number of decimals. Note: Quantities may be entered if Transfer quantities on the Wage type transfer details maintenance panel has been specified for the wage type.
